Towards a common vocabulary of practice – Looking back to imagine the future A team of educators, historians, architects and associated academics headed up by Catherine Burke from the Faculty of Education University of Cambridge have completed studies of a series of primary schools designed by David and Mary Medd, architects. A series of short stories in film have been made by the team during visits to three schools with David Medd.
